Wall paper borders are decorative strips used to enhance the design of a room. They are versatile and come in different styles and materials. Below are some of the types of wallpaper borders:
Vinyl Wallpaper Borders
Vinyl wallpaper borders are made with vinyl. They are popular because they are long-lasting and easy to clean. They can be used in different rooms, such as the kitchen and bathroom. These vinyl wallpaper borders are known for their practicality and versatility. They come in various designs, from plain to patterns with flowers or geometric shapes. They are also available in different colors. The borders are easy to install. They can be removed and replaced when needed. These borders can withstand moisture. They are also resistant to stains and mildew. They maintain their appearance for a long time.
Paper Wallpaper Borders
Paper wallpaper borders are made from paper material. They are not as popular as vinyl borders because they are not durable. They are, however, lightweight and easy to install. These borders are known for their eco-friendliness. They are made from recycled materials. They are also available in different colors and designs. Users can easily find a design that matches their room theme. Paper wallpaper borders are also customizable. They come in different finishes, such as glossy or matte.
Fabric Wallpaper Borders
Fabric wallpaper borders are made from fabric materials. They add texture and warmth to a room. They are mostly used in bedrooms and living rooms. These borders are available in different types of fabrics, such as silk, cotton, and burlap. They come in different patterns, from lace trims to bold, woven designs. Fabric wallpaper borders are easy to install. They require special adhesive to stick to the wall. They are also delicate and require proper maintenance.
Lace Wallpaper Borders
Lace wallpaper borders are intricate and delicate. They are made from woven lace material. These borders add a touch of elegance and femininity to a room. They are mostly used in bedrooms and dining areas. Lace wallpaper borders are available in different types of lace patterns. They are also available in different colors, from white to black. They create a beautiful visual effect. They also allow light to pass through.
Wood Wallpaper Borders
Wood wallpaper borders are decorative strips made of wood. They add a natural and rustic feel to a room. These borders are mostly used in cabins or country-style homes. They are crafted from different types of wood, such as oak, pine, and cedar. Wood wallpaper borders are available in different finishes, from stained to painted. They are also available in different widths and thicknesses. These borders are durable and long-lasting. They require proper maintenance to prevent wear and tear.
Metallic Wallpaper Borders
Metallic wallpaper borders are decorative strips with metallic finishes. They add glamour and sophistication to a room. These borders are available in different materials, such as foil, metal, and paper with metallic accents. They are also available in different colors, such as gold, silver, and copper. Metallic wallpaper borders are known for their reflective surfaces. They create a stunning focal point in any room.
Wall paper borders serve both functional and aesthetic purposes in interior design. Here are some key functions and features of wallpaper borders:
Decorative Framing
Wallpaper borders frame the room, creating a visual separation between the walls and ceiling. They can enhance the overall decor by adding color, pattern, and texture. Wallpaper borders also add an extra layer of design interest that draws the eye.
Hiding Imperfections
Borders can cover minor flaws, cracks, or uneven lines where walls meet the ceiling. They help to mask imperfections and provide a finished look to the room. Wallpaper borders can also hide edges where different wall coverings meet.
Defining Spaces
They can be used to define specific areas within a room, such as separating a seating area from the rest of the room. Wallpaper borders can also create the illusion of height or width, depending on their placement and design. Horizontal borders can make a room feel wider, while vertical ones can add to the sense of height.
Customization
Homeowners can design their borders to match their personal style and the room's theme. This customization allows for a unique touch in each space. They come in various materials, including paper, vinyl, fabric, and painted options, providing flexibility in design choices.
Easy Application and Removal
Modern wallpaper borders are generally easy to apply and remove. They can be repositioned during installation to achieve the desired look. Many borders use peel-and-stick technology, allowing for hassle-free application and removal when styles change.
Material Variety
Wallpaper border materials include paper, vinyl, and fabric, each offering different aesthetic and practical benefits. Paper borders are often more detailed, while vinyl ones are durable and washable. Fabric borders add a textured, luxurious feel.
Pattern and Color
Borders are available in various patterns, such as floral, geometric, or scenic designs. They can include contrasting or complementary colors, impacting the room's ambiance significantly. Dark borders can add coziness, while light ones contribute to an airy feel.
Scale and Placement
The scale of the border's pattern should be considered in relation to the room's size. In smaller rooms, narrower patterns may work better, while larger spaces can handle bolder designs. Correct placement is crucial; high borders can draw the eyes upward, enhancing ceiling height.
Wallpaper borders are versatile design elements that can enhance the aesthetic appeal of various spaces. Here are some common usage scenarios:
Residential Interiors
Living Rooms: Wallpaper borders can define spaces or highlight architectural features such as moldings, chair rails, or fireplace mantels. They add a touch of elegance to living rooms.
Kitchens: They can be used to create a traditional or country-style look by placing a border at the top of the wall or between the countertop and the wall. This adds a decorative element and makes cleaning easier.
Bedrooms: Wallpaper borders are suitable for kids' rooms. They feature characters, animals, or inspirational quotes that add a playful or whimsical touch. Also, they can be used to create a vintage or romantic ambiance by using floral, damask, or toile patterns.
Commercial Spaces
Offices: Office spaces benefit from motivational or inspirational wallpaper borders that can be installed on walls, cubicle dividers, or conference room walls to promote a positive and energizing environment.
Hospitality Venues: Restaurants and cafes use wallpaper borders to create a cozy and intimate dining experience. Borders with food-related themes or simple patterns complement the overall decor. In hotel lobbies, borders add luxury and depth to the space.
Healthcare Facilities: Hospitals and clinics use wallpaper borders in pediatric wards, creating a friendly and comforting atmosphere for children and their families. Wallpaper borders with nature themes or soft colors are suitable for patient rooms.
Educational Institutions
Classrooms: Inspirational quotes and learning-themed borders can be installed around bulletin boards or the top of the walls to foster a positive learning environment and stimulate children's creativity and motivation.
Libraries: Borders with literary themes or calm patterns create a serene and inspiring atmosphere for reading and studying.
Childcare Centers: Bright, playful, and educational borders can be placed on walls, windows, and furniture to create a stimulating and cheerful environment for young children.
Creative Applications
Artistic Projects: Borders can be used by artists to create mixed-media artworks or to frame paintings and drawings. They add dimensionality and texture to the artworks.
DIY Home Decor: Individuals use wallpaper borders to personalize furniture, such as dressers, bookshelves, or picture frames. They add unique patterns and colors to match the room's decor.
Wallpaper borders are available in different materials, colors, patterns, and sizes. So, choosing the right one can be difficult. But it doesn't have to be that way. Here is a guide on how to choose the right border for a room.
Consider the Style of the Room
First, one should consider the room's style. A wallpaper border is a small accessory that can change how a room looks. It is important to choose a border that matches the room style. For example, if the room is decorated in a modern style, a border with clean lines and simple colors would be a good choice. On the other hand, if the room has a traditional style, a border with classic patterns and colors would be better.
Pay Attention to Scale
When choosing a wallpaper border, it is important to pay attention to scale. This means considering the size of the border compared to the size of the room and the other things in it. A big border can make a small room look even smaller. On the other hand, a small border can get lost in a big room.
Well, one should not worry too much about getting the perfect size. It is more important to choose a border that works well with the room.
Think About the Color
The color of a wallpaper border is very important. A border with dark colors can make a ceiling look lower or a wall look shorter. But light-colored borders can do the opposite - they can make a ceiling look higher or make a wall look taller.
Material
Another thing to consider when choosing a wallpaper border is the material it is made of. Borders can be made from paper, fabric, or vinyl. Paper borders are usually cheaper, but they are also less durable. Vinyl borders are very popular because they last a long time and are easy to clean. Fabric borders look nice, but they can be more difficult to care for.
Pattern Matching
For those who love patterns, it is important to make sure they match when putting them up. This is called pattern alignment. It can be tricky, but taking time to cut the pieces correctly so the patterns line up is worth it. A well-aligned pattern makes the room look professional.
Q: What are wallpaper borders?
A: Wallpaper borders are strips of decorative paper or fabric that are applied to the wall just below the ceiling line. They come in different colors, patterns, and materials that match or complement the wallpaper in a room.
Q: How to apply a wallpaper border?
A: To apply a wallpaper border, first clean the area where it will be placed. Measure and cut the border to fit the desired space. Apply the appropriate adhesive based on the border material and carefully press it into place, ensuring it is level.
Q: How to remove a wallpaper border?
A: Removing a wallpaper border involves soaking it with warm water mixed with a border remover solution to loosen the adhesive. Start from one end and peel it off slowly. Any leftover adhesive can be removed with a scraper and adhesive remover.
Q: Are wallpaper borders out of style?
A: Wallpaper borders are not out of style. They are used to divide walls and ceilings, adding character and charm to a room. Currently, people are using wider borders that match the wallpaper or painting on the walls instead of the traditional narrow border.
Q: Should a wallpaper border be straight or wavy?
A: There is no right or wrong way, just personal preference. A straight border looks clean and modern, while a wavy border adds a whimsical, vintage touch. It's best to choose the shape that fits the style of the room.
